Many Disciples Desert Jesus
65 And he said, "Because of this I said to you that no one can come to me unless it has been granted to him by the Father." 66 For this [reason] many of his disciples {drew back} and were not walking with him any longer. 67 So Jesus said to the twelve, "You do not want to go away also, [do you]?"
